The influence of China culture on the world can be traced back to the Neoliths around 5000 B.C. In the long-term development process, Chinese culture not only had a far-reaching impact in China, but also had an important impact on the culture, art, philosophy, religion, politics and other fields of other countries in the world. Many important cultural events and inventions in China history had a profound impact on the world. For example, Chinese characters were one of the most widely used characters in the world, which had influenced the culture, art, education, science, and other fields in East Asia; China traditional festivals and customs such as the Spring Festival, the Dragon Boat Festival, and the Mid-Autumn Festival had become worldwide festivals and cultural phenomena; China's martial arts, traditional Chinese medicine, and tea culture had also had a wide impact on the world. As time passed, the influence of China culture continued to expand. China's status and influence in global affairs continued to rise, and Chinese culture was receiving more and more attention and attention from countries around the world. For example, China's cultural products have become one of the favorite products of consumers around the world, and China's soft power is constantly increasing.

Well, the time in the story can greatly affect the plot. If it's a short period, things might be more intense and fast - paced. For example, in a thriller set over a day, every minute counts for the protagonist to solve the mystery or escape danger.
The world development system can influence the readership of light novels in several ways. For example, in a well - developed economy (part of the world development system), more people may have the disposable income to buy light novels. Also, a developed education system might produce more literate individuals interested in reading various forms of literature, including light novels.
